comparemela.com

Top Locations Tagged with Santa Cruz Community Health Centers

Santa Cruz Community Health Centers in United States - 06153/Physicians-surgeons near Santa Cruz

1). Santa Cruz Community Health Centers, Locust St

vimarsana © 2020. All Rights Reserved.